     54 static __inline void userret __P((struct lwp *, int,  u_quad_t));
     55 /*
     56  * Define the code needed before returning to user mode, for
     57  * trap, mem_access_fault, and syscall.
     58  */
     59 static __inline void
     60 userret(struct lwp *l, int pc, u_quad_t oticks)
     61 {
     62 	struct proc *p = l->l_proc;
     63 
     64 	mi_userret(l);
     65 
     66 	if (want_ast) {
     67 		want_ast = 0;
     68 		if (p->p_flag & P_OWEUPC) {
     69 			p->p_flag &= ~P_OWEUPC;
     70 			ADDUPROF(p);
     71 		}
     72 	}
     73 
     74 	/*
     75 	 * If profiling, charge recent system time to the trapped pc.
     76 	 */
     77 	if (p->p_flag & P_PROFIL)
     78 		addupc_task(p, pc, (int)(p->p_sticks - oticks));
     79 
     80 	curcpu()->ci_schedstate.spc_curpriority = l->l_priority = l->l_usrpri;
     81 }

     83 static __inline void share_fpu __P((struct lwp *, struct trapframe64 *));
     84 /*
     85  * If someone stole the FPU while we were away, do not enable it
     86  * on return.  This is not done in userret() above as it must follow
     87  * the ktrsysret() in syscall().  Actually, it is likely that the
     88  * ktrsysret should occur before the call to userret.
     89  *
     90  * Oh, and don't touch the FPU bit if we're returning to the kernel.
     91  */
     92 static __inline void
     93 share_fpu(struct lwp *l, struct trapframe64 *tf)
     94 {
     95 	if (!(tf->tf_tstate & (PSTATE_PRIV << TSTATE_PSTATE_SHIFT)) &&
     96 	    fplwp != l)
     97 		tf->tf_tstate &= ~(PSTATE_PEF << TSTATE_PSTATE_SHIFT);
     98 }
